def file_dependencies(file, prev = {})
deps = @dependencies[file]
prev[file] = true
if deps
deps = deps.map { |x|
if prev[x]
msg = "Circular dependency detected #{file} => #{x}"
App.warn msg
deps = []
#fail msg
else
file_dependencies(x, prev)
end
}
else
deps = []
end
deps << file
deps
end
def ordered_build_files
@ordered_build_files ||= begin
@files.flatten.map { |file| file_dependencies(file) }.flatten.uniq
end
end
